How Common Is The Last Name Theilmann? popularity and diffusion

Theilmann is the 316,181st most frequent surname on earth, borne by approximately 1 in 6,144,642 people. This surname occurs predominantly in Europe, where 82 percent of Theilmann live; 71 percent live in Western Europe and 68 percent live in Germanic Europe.

Theilmann is most frequently used in Germany, where it is held by 802 people, or 1 in 100,381. In Germany it is most numerous in: Lower Saxony, where 37 percent live, Baden-Württemberg, where 27 percent live and Rhineland-Palatinate, where 20 percent live. Barring Germany it occurs in 11 countries. It is also found in The United States, where 14 percent live and Denmark, where 10 percent live.

Theilmann Family Population Trend historical fluctuation

The incidence of Theilmann has changed through the years. In The United States the share of the population with the surname rose 654 percent between 1880 and 2014 and in England it rose 117 percent between 1881 and 2014.
